Three Training Modes,Help Patients Recover Comprehensively
Innovative Mirror Training
Using the principle of "exercise re-learning"to reshape the brain nerve.
Hand dysfunction is more than hand problem.It's more about nerve damage.
The mirror training,the healthy hand drives the affected hand, synchronizes the movement of both hands,activates the mirror neurons,copies the normal healthy hand motor neural pathway to the affected hand,promotes the autonomic recovery of the brain and speeds up the rehabilitation process of hand function.

By superimposing the intact arm on the phantom Limb using a mirror reflection,patients reported the sensation that they could move and relax the often-cramped phantom limb and experienced pain relief. Since this initial report,successful use of mirror therapy has been reported in patients with other pain syndromes,such as complex regional pain syndrome,10.11and in sensory re-education of severe hyperesthesia after hand injuries.12 Previous studies in stroke. although undersized and not sufficiently controlled,suggested that mirror therapy may be beneficial for motor function recovery in the paretic hand. 3-15 In a randomized crossover study of 9 chronic stroke patients. Altschuler et al'reported that range of motion (ROM),speed, and accuracy of arm movement were more improved after mirror therapy. Stevens and Stoykov's also reported that their 2 stroke patients trained with mirror therapy for 3 to 4 weeks and had an increase in Fugl-Meyer. Assessment score,active.
